Random Listing

403 Pleasant Valley Road South

Groton, CT

305 South Main Street

Canandaigua, NY

1081 East Tallmadge Avenue

Akron, OH

1035 Market Street

Warren, PA

122 Fm 1960 By-Pass Road East

Humble, TX

Pizza Restaurants in Odessa

Below is a list of pizza restaurants located in Odessa. Click on the name to see details about the pizza restaurant

Village Take Out Pizzeria

110 Main

Odessa, NY

Village Take Out Pizzeria

Give Village Take Out Pizzeria premium priority and full business description